Rare Charlton & Co. Platinum Diamond and Demantoid Stick Pin
This refined Charlton & Co. Art Deco diamond and demantoid garnet stick pin showcases the elegance and craftsmanship associated with Charlton & Co., the distinguished New York jewelry house active in the early twentieth century. Jewelry created by Charlton & Co. is admired for its precise gemstone settings, refined platinum work, and sophisticated design.
At the center of this exceptional Charlton & Co. stick pin sits a remarkable approximately 1 carat old mine cut diamond, displaying the soft brilliance and character that collectors prize in antique diamonds. The diamond is framed by delicate milgrain detailing and surrounded by a vivid halo of calibré-cut demantoid garnets, whose rich green color creates a striking contrast with the diamond’s brilliance.
The circular halo composition reflects the elegant geometry associated with Art Deco jewelry, while the refined platinum setting highlights the quality craftsmanship that defines Charlton & Co. jewelry. Pieces by Charlton & Co. are increasingly sought after by collectors for their combination of rare gemstones, distinctive design, and historical significance.
This elegant Charlton & Co. Art Deco diamond and demantoid garnet stick pin would have originally been worn on a gentleman’s tie or lapel, embodying the refined style of the period. Today, such finely crafted Charlton & Co. pieces remain highly collectible examples of early twentieth-century American jewelry.
• Maker: Charlton & Co.
• Period: Art Deco
• Center Stone: Approximately 1 carat old mine cut diamond
• Surrounding Stones: Calibré-cut demantoid garnets
• Design: Classic halo / target motif
• Metal: Platinum
• Origin: New York
• Category: Fine stick pin
